Protect against surfaceController and hasSurface getting out of sync.
WindowStateAnimator.mSurfaceController is set to null whenever a
surface is destroyed and WindowState.mHasSurface is set to false
shortly after that. However, it is possible for them to get out
of sync in a couple of places due to exceptions or duplicate destroy.
Consolidated the call to set WindowState.mHasSurface inside a finally
block in WindowStateAnimator.destroySurface
Also, cleaned up the code a little to that it is more obvious what is
going on.
